This portable credential - powered by ACT WorkKeys - verifies to employers that an individual has essential core skills in reading for information, locating information, and applied mathematics.
WorkKeys are administered to all students enrolling in a career development program. Prior to graduation, students must attain Work Keys scores as established by the Ohio Department of Education.
The assessment takes approximately three hours to complete and is held at the TCTC Adult Training Center in Champion. Students who qualify will receive a Career Readiness Certificate from ACT. To help prepare for WorkKeys tests, study guides, use WIN.

These three skills are highly important to the majority of jobs. The certificate offers individuals, employers, and educators an easily understood credential that certifies the attainment of these workplace skills.
WorkKeys assessments are administered at the TCTC Adult Training Center and at the Trumbull County One Stop.
TCTC's Adult Training Center is a licensed ACT WorkKeys assessment site.
